MailKit is an Open Source cross-platform .NET mail-client library that is based on MimeKit and optimized for mobile devices.

Features include:
* HTTP, Socks4, Socks4a and Socks5 proxy support.
* SASL Authentication via SCRAM-SHA-256, SCRAM-SHA-1, NTLM, DIGEST-MD5, CRAM-MD5, LOGIN, PLAIN, and XOAUTH2.
* A fully-cancellable SmtpClient with support for STARTTLS, 8BITMIME, BINARYMIME, ENHANCEDSTATUSCODES, SIZE, DSN, PIPELINING and SMTPUTF8.
* A fully-cancellable Pop3Client with support for STLS, UIDL, APOP, PIPELINING, UTF8, and LANG.
* A fully-cancellable ImapClient with support for ACL, QUOTA, LITERAL+, IDLE, NAMESPACE, ID, CHILDREN, LOGINDISABLED, STARTTLS, MULTIAPPEND, UNSELECT, UIDPLUS, CONDSTORE, ESEARCH, SASL-IR, COMPRESS, WITHIN, ENABLE, QRESYNC, SORT, THREAD, LIST-EXTENDED, ESORT, METADATA / METADATA-SERVER, NOTIFY, FILTERS, LIST-STATUS, SORT=DISPLAY, SPECIAL-USE / CREATE-SPECIAL-USE, SEARCH=FUZZY, MOVE, UTF8=ACCEPT / UTF8=ONLY, LITERAL-, APPENDLIMIT, STATUS=SIZE, OBJECTID, XLIST, and X-GM-EXT1.
* Client-side sorting and threading of messages (the Ordinal Subject and the Jamie Zawinski threading algorithms are supported).
* Asynchronous versions of all methods that hit the network.
* S/MIME, OpenPGP, DKIM and ARC support via MimeKit.
* Microsoft TNEF support via MimeKit.

* Improved the default SSL/TLS certificate validation logic.
* Improved exception messages for the POP3 LIST and STAT commands.
* Modified Pop3Client to accept negative values for the 'octets' value in the STAT response. (issue #872)
* Added work-around for IMAP BODYSTRUCTURE responses that treat multiparts as basic parts. (issue #878)
* Added check to make sure that MD5 is supported by the runtime and automatically disable support for CRAM-MD5 and DIGEST-MD5 SASL mechanisms when MD5 is not supported.
* Added a Stream property to ProtocolLogger.
* Fixed fetching of PreviewText items if the body's ContentTransferEncoding is NIL. (issue #881)
* Improved processing of pipelined SMTP commands to provide better exception messages. (issue #883)
* Modified SmtpClient.Send() and SendAsync() methods to not call MimeMessage.Prepare() if any DKIM or ARC headers are present in order to avoid the potential risk of altering the message and breaking the signatures within those headers.
* Added protected SmtpClient.SendCommand() and SendCommandAsync() methods to allow custom subclasses the ability to send custom commands to the SMTP server. (issue #891)
* Allow SmtpClient subclasses to override message preparation by overriding a new SmtpClient.Prepare() method. (issue #891)
* Improved ImapFolder's ModSeqChanged event to set the UniqueId property if available in unsolicited FETCH notifications including a MODSEQ and UID value.
* Fixed the IMAP client logic to properly handle lower or mixed case IMAP tokens. (issue #893)
* Added support for IMAP's ANNOTATE-EXPERIMENT-1 extension. (issue #818)
* Always use the SMTP BDAT command instead of DATA if CHUNKING is supported. (issue #896)
* Improved SmtpClient to include a SIZE= parameter in the MAIL FROM command if the SIZE extension is supported. Progress reporting will now always have the expected message size available as well.

API Changes Since 2.0.x:

* Obsoleted SearchQuery.HasCustomFlags() and SearchQuery.DoesNotHaveCustomFlags(). These are now SearchQuery.HasKeywords() and SearchQuery.NotKeywords(), respectively.
* Obsoleted SearchQuery.DoesNotHaveFlags() in favor of SearchQuery.NotFlags().
* Obsoleted the IMessageSummary.UserFlags property in favor of IMessageSummary.Keywords.
* Obsoleted the MessageFlagsChangedEventArgs.UserFlags property in favor of MessageFlagsChangedEventArgs.Keywords.
* All IMailFolder.Fetch and IMailFolder.FetchAsync methods that took a HashSet<string> userFlags argument now take an IEnumerable<string> keywords argument. Note: this only affects you if your code used named method parameters (e.g. userFlags: myUserFlags).

Note to users upgrading from MailKit 1.x:

In order to authenticate using the XOAUTH2 SASL mechanism, you must now use the following approach:

client.Authenticate (new SaslMechanismOAuth2 (username, auth_token));
